October Unemployment Figures Drop In Michigan

DETROIT (WWJ) - Unemployment fell in October in all 17 of Michigan's major labor markets.

The state agency that released the figures says the overall jobless rate last month was 9.2 percent, compared with 10.1 percent in September.

The state says the lower numbers reflect seasonal reductions in the work force.

The Detroit region still has the state's highest unemployment rate, at 10.8 percent, but that's better than October, 2010, when the rate was 12.2 percent.

The Ann Arbor region, at 5.7 percent, has the state's lowest unemployment rate.
